Abstract
This paper discussed an optical current transducer which had a bulk Faraday sensor inserted into a gapped iron core and porcelain insulator with built-in optical fibers.The Faraday sensor had Bi12SiO20 single crystals with right and left optical rotatory power to cancel out temperture dependency. And a 66 kV to 275 kV class insulator with built-in optical fibers was also confirmed to have the required optical transmission performance. A prototype 161 kV optical current transducer demonstrated 0.3 % class accurracy for metering.
